You will first learn the languages, frameworks and tools to slot into an agile development team.
Essentials Modules
This is the introduction to front-end software development and key UX techniques where you will gain competency in the top three programming languages, CSS, JavaScript & Python. You’ll then demonstrate that knowledge in three projects which will become a showcase of your skills to employers.
Full-Stack Toolkit Modules
Here you will learn how to access databases and use tools like Bootstrap, Django, JQuery, PyTest & Jest. You will discover how to test code, how agile development teams work and complete your full stack project. You’re now ready to add an advanced specialist skill and complete your qualification.
